ISO 28540:2011 specifies a method for the determination of at least 16 selected PAH (see Table 1) in drinking water and ground water in mass concentrations above 0,005 µg/l and surface water in mass concentrations above 0,01 µg/l (for each individual compound). ISO 28540:2011 can be used for samples containing up to 150 mg/l of suspended matter. This method is, with some modification, also suitable for the analysis of waste water. It is possible that this method is applicable to other PAH, provided the method is validated for each case.

Overview
ISO 28540:2011 - "Water quality - Determination of 16 pol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AH) in water - Method using gas chromatography with mass spectrometric detection (GC‑MS)" - specifies a validated laboratory procedure for measuring at least 16 priority PAH in drinking water, groundwater and surface water using GC‑MS. The method covers individual compound mass concentrations above 0.005 µg/L (drinking and ground water) and 0.01 µg/L (surface water), and is suitable for samples with up to 150 mg/L suspended matter. With appropriate validation or modification it can be adapted for wastewater and additional PAH.
Key technical topics and requirements
- Analytes: 16 PAH listed in Table 1 (includes benzo[a]pyrene, indeno[1,2,3‑cd]pyrene, benzo[b]fluoranthene, etc.).
- Sample preparation: Liquid–liquid extraction (hexane) with internal standards added prior to extraction; extracts concentrated and re‑solvated for cleanup or GC injection.
- Standards & internal controls: Use of isotopically labelled internal standards (minimum three) and an injection standard to monitor recovery and instrument response.
- Chromatography & detection: GC separation on fused silica capillary columns (non‑polar or slightly polar polysiloxane) capable of resolving critical pairs (e.g., benzo[a]pyrene / benzo[e]pyrene); identification/quantification by mass spectrometry with electron impact ionization (EI) and selective ion monitoring (SIM/SIR) where appropriate.
- Quality criteria & interferences: Guidance on resolution (e.g., R ≥ 0.8 for certain critical peak pairs), handling co‑eluting interferents, storage and sampling precautions (avoid plastics, use amber containers), and limits on suspended solids. Recommended reagent and gas purities (hexane, acetonitrile, nitrogen, helium) and precleaning (anhydrous sodium sulfate).
- Documentation & annexes: Includes examples of GC‑MS conditions, precision/accuracy data, apparatus construction and chromatograms to support method implementation.
